Student Research Poster Forum – ESEM26

1. Overview

The Student Research Poster Forum is a dedicated academic platform within ESEM 2026 designed to promote student-led research, innovation, and clinical learning in Emergency Medicine.

The forum will bring together top student researchers from universities across the region and internationally, creating a structured environment for presentation, evaluation, and recognition.

4. Submission Criteria

Eligibility
  • Medical students / interns / residents/Paramedics/Nursing
  • Student must be first author and presenter
Submission Categories
  • Original Research
  • Case Reports
  • Quality Improvement / Audit
  • Innovation / EMS / Simulation
Abstract Requirements
  • 250–300 words
  • Structured format:
    • Background
    • Objectives
    • Methods
    • Results
    • Conclusion
  • Faculty supervisor’s information mandatory

6. Review & Selection Process

Stage 1: Scientific Review
  • Conducted by ESEM Scientific Committee
  • Criteria:
    • Relevance to Emergency Medicine
    • Scientific quality
    • Originality
    • Clarity
Stage 2: Final Selection
  • Accepted abstracts assigned to poster presentation category/ Student presentation Session
  • Top-scoring submissions shortlisted for awards

7. Poster Presentation Format

Session Structure
  • The Student Research Poster Forum will be held during dedicated, scheduled poster sessions within the official conference program
  • E- Posters will be displayed in a designated poster area
Presentation Format
  • Each presenter:
    • Displays E-poster onsite
    • Delivers 3–5 minute explanation
    • Engages with judges and attendees

8. Evaluation (Onsite Judging)

Criteria Weight
Scientific Content30%
Originality & Impact20%
Poster Clarity & Design15%
Data Presentation10%
Presenter Knowledge & Q&A15%
Overall Impression10%
